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Work
Feeling unsure what to say is normal. Use low-pressure, profile-based openers that invite a response without sounding rehearsed. Below are adaptable patterns and examples you can tweak to fit the person you’re messaging.
Quick patterns to try
- Observation + question: Notice one specific detail from their profile, then ask a light question. Example: “I see you hike—what trail would you recommend for someone who hates steep hills?”
- Two-choice prompt: Give two clear options to lower the effort of replying. Example: “Coffee or tea on a rainy Sunday?”
- Genuine curiosity: Ask about a hobby in a way that assumes positive knowledge. Example: “You make pottery—what’s your favorite thing to create?”
- Playful callout: Mention something quirky and invite a quick vote. Example: “Pineapple on pizza: culinary crime or guilty pleasure?”
How to adapt without sounding copy-paste
- Use one detail from their profile each time. Even a small fact—favorite band, pet, or photo location—makes the message feel personal.
- Keep messages short and specific. Three lines or fewer is fine; long essays create pressure.
- Use their name once if it feels natural. Avoid overdoing compliments—focus on curiosity rather than flattery.
- Swap wording to match your voice. If you’re casual, keep it casual; if you’re more formal, choose a slightly polished opener.
What to avoid
- Avoid generic one-word openers like “hey” or “sup.” They put the burden on the other person to carry the conversation.
- Skip overly intense questions on first contact (life goals, relationship history, deeply personal topics). Save those for later when there’s rapport.
- Don’t lead with heavy compliments about appearance. Instead, reference an action or interest to invite conversation.
- Avoid copy-paste lines that don’t reference their profile. If it could apply to anyone, rewrite it.
Small follow-ups that keep the chat going
- If they answer a question, reply with a short follow-up that adds something about you. Example: “Nice—I’ve been meaning to try that trail. I usually go to X when I want an easy hike.”
- Use light callbacks to earlier messages. Example: “You mentioned you love street food—what’s the best bite you’ve had recently?”
- If a message stalls, send a friendly one-liner that offers an easy out. Example: “No rush—if you’re still up for chatting, I’m curious about your favorite weekend ritual.”
